I’ve said it before, and I’ll say it again: Wonder Woman AKA Diana Prince was one of the very best parts of Batman v. Superman.

And the closer we get to June 2017, the more excited I am to see her origin story!

Today Warner Bros. released a new trailer from the upcoming superhero adventure where we see more of Diana’s life on Themyscira, the battles she wages with the other Amazonian women, and her decision to eventually join Steve Trevor to stop the world from destroying itself in the war to end all wars (World War I).

I’m already blown away by the incredible action sequences, the romance is swooning me, and there are some pretty funny moments too.

Wonder Woman hits movie theaters around the world next summer when Gal Gadot returns as the title character in the epic action adventure from director Patty Jenkins. Before she was Wonder Woman, she was Diana, princess of the Amazons, trained to be an unconquerable warrior. Raised on a sheltered island paradise, when an American pilot crashes on their shores and tells of a massive conflict raging in the outside world, Diana leaves her home, convinced she can stop the threat. Fighting alongside man in a war to end all wars, Diana will discover her full powers…and her true destiny.

Joining Gadot in the international cast are Chris Pine, Connie Nielsen, Robin Wright, David Thewlis, Danny Huston, Elena Anaya, Ewen Bremner and Saïd Taghmaoui. Jenkins directs the film from a screenplay by Allan Heinberg and Geoff Johns, story by Zack Snyder & Allan Heinberg, based on characters from DC Entertainment.
